纳米磁流体密封结构的设计和制造

摘    要:论述了磁流体及其密封的原理和特点,介绍了密封结构的形式、密封元件的组成、密封结构设计的分类和步骤,研究了密封结构参数对密封能力的影响及各参数的选取原则,针对一具体情况,选择一源二极密封部件进行研究,具体设计并制作出一个30级密封结构元件,讨论了加工和安装过程中应注意的问题。

DESIGN AND MANUFACTURE OF SEALING ELEMENT OF NANOMAGNETIC FLUIDS

Abstract:Magnetic fluids, its sealing mechanism, and its sealing characters are brief summarized. The types and components of sealing element, and classification and steps of sealing element designing are introduced. The effect of sealing element parameters on sealing performance, the selection principle of sealing element parameters are studied. In accordance with a concrete situation, a sealing element of one magnetic source and two magnetic poles is selected and researched. A 30 stages of sealing element is designed practically. The issues warranted careful consideration in the process of manufacture and installation of sealing element are discussed.
